PROBLEM CAUSE CORRECTION
APPLIANCE OPERATION
Appliance
does not run.
Appliance is plugged into a
circuit that has a ground
fault interrupt.
Temperature Control is in the
OFF position or POWER OFF
position.
Appliance may not be
plugged in or plug is loose.
Hose fuse blown or tripped
circuit breaker.
Power outage
Use another circuit. If you are unsure
about the outlet, have it checked by a
certied technician.
See Setting the Temperature
Control section.
Ensure plug is tightly pushed into outlet.
Check/replace fuse with a 15-amp time-delay
fuse. Reset circuit breaker.
Check house lights. Call local electric company.
Appliance
runs too much
or too long.
Room or outside weather
is hot.
Appliance has recently been
disconnected for a period
of time.
Large amounts of warm
or hot food have been
stored recently.
Door is opened too frequently
or too long.
Door may be slightly open.
Temperature control is set
too low.
Gasket is dirty, worn, cracked,
or poorly tted.
It’s normal for the appliance to work longer
under these conditions.
It takes 4 hours for the appliance to cool
down completely.
Warm food will cause appliance to run more
until the desired temperature is reached.
Warm air entering the appliance causes it to
run more. Open door less often.
Ensure door is tightly closed.
Turn control knob to a warmer setting. Allow
several hours for the temperature to stabilize.
Clean or change gasket. Leaks in door seal
will cause appliance to run longer in order to
maintain desired temperatures.
Pressing the “-”
or “+” buttons
on the control
panel does not
change the set
points
Verify the control panel is not
locked or in Sabbath Mode.
To unlock, press and hold “Set” button for
3 seconds; to exit Sabbath Mode press and
hold “Set” and “Options” for 5 seconds.
APPLIANCE TEMPERATURES
Interior tem-
perature is
too cold.
Control is set too low.
The appliance is in Quick
Freeze mode.
Set control to a warmer setting. Allow several
hours for temperature to stabilize.
Exit Quick Freeze mode by entering into
the options menu on the control panel and
pressing the “set” button once the indicator is
highlighted next to “Quick Freeze”.
